Guard Dog Security 160 Lumen Tactical Flashlight with Stun Gun

Guard Dog Security 160 Lumen Tactical Flashlight with Stun Gun

  • First device of its kind, combining 160-lumen tactical field light with added security of a 4.5 million volt stun gun
  • Patented inner-stun technology with powered probes completely embedded within outer layer of flashlight
  • Type III aircraft grade aluminum alloy body with anti-roll design; 100,000-hour bulb
  • Enhanced reflector system for optimum brightness; accidental discharge security switch and one-hand operation of all functions
  • 6.75-inch length; includes nylon carry case and fully rechargeable battery

The world’s first tactical light with stun gun has arrived in the Guard Dog Diablo! The Diablo shines a blinding 160 lumen light to illuminate far and bright, yet also effective for tactical and security purposes. Fire up the 4,500,000v concealed stun and the cognitive Diablo turns into a volt trashing self-defense device, powerful enough to fend and immobilize and attacker.     I bought the first one for my wife, who sometimes has to leave the office at night and walk 1-2 blocks in a high crime area. While, I wish that she would leave during daylight hours or carry a gun, she is not comfortable with that, nor do we want to deal with the aftermath of lethally shooting someone.

    I spent some time training her and she is now ready to use it. Here’s what she does:

    1. Puts the lanyard on her wrist. This is important so she doesn’t accidentally drop the light or have it knocked away.

    2. Uses the flashlight to illuminate her path. It is very powerful light, with a good wide throw and helps her to see her surroundings well. What is an added plus is that if she is approached, by an attacker, she can direct it to shine in their face which will temporarily blind/disorient them…and what happens when someone shines a bright light in your face? You put up your hands to sheild your eyes. In terms of an attacker, he is now giving you a target to use the business end of the stun gun.

    3. I showed her how to switch it on so she understands how loud and powerful it is. I also instructed her not to jab, but to hold and press the stun gun end against the assailant for 2-3 seconds. A short jab will only deliver a short burst, but if you hold it on them for 2-3 seconds, the full current will be deployed, disabling their muscle control and they will fall to the ground. This will incapacitate the attacker for a few minutes…enough time for her to run away.

    We practiced this (without the battery in it) until she was comfortable and quick. I hope she doesn’t have to use it, but at least now knowing she is ready to protect herself, I can rest easier.

    PROS:

    - lanyard: use to prevent accidental dropping or getting knocked away from you.
    - body: a sturdy, well made casing. Strong enough for smashing glass…or noses
    - light: very bright, useful for lighting up a clear wide view as well as momentarily blinding an attacker
    - controls: easy to use, logical in layout

    CONS
    - I do worry about accidentally going off in her purse. Wish the switch had a better safety configuration.

    NOTE: I recommend rehearsing several times on how to use it. If you or your loved one is under attack, adrenaline will be high, thinking time will be short and there will be small room for error …so I highly recommend practicing.

    It definetely makes and impressive loud noise when activated & I am glad my girlfriend has not had to use it at all.

    I think it should be clearly stated that five inches of the over-all body is metal & the rear one inch (the charging female part of it) is plastic. This particular design makes the rear part of it breakable big-time. The attachment of the rear plastic section of it does not feel very solid.

    I used this product for about three weeks before letting my girl try it out. Unfortunately I was not able to give her the lanyard since it broke about the fourth day of using it(cheap material for show only) so make sure you get a good heavy duty lanyard if you plan to buy this product.

    The holder has a open design which does not help keep this product in place. My girl complained that when she looks for it in her hand bag she will often find the flashlight out of the holder. So you will have to get a better holder cover for it..that is for sure, so keep that it mind.

    Manual is not as descriptive, lacks specifications & states facts that are not true at all. For example, you are supposed to charge your product for a few hours until you see a green light turn-on. Well, that never happen after a seven hour charge. I used common sense since electronics of that size should not take more than six hours, but I left it for seven just in case.

    Still i think that should be described in the manual or at least, something like ” use common sense while charging” or actually making it happen so that you can know that it is fully charged. Power cord is really short too..so same thing there boys.

    If by any chance you accidentaly have the switch on-stun mode(which happens often with that cheap holder) the tip of it will give you a WAKE-UP-shock very minimal but will wake-up you up for sure or freak you-out if you are a drama queen.
